# median elm I saw that information, but the email sort of implied otherwise. Why does it g...

As it says on buy.immich.app

Building Immich takes a lot of time and effort, and we have full-time engineers working on it to make it as good as we possibly can. Our mission is for open-source software and ethical business practices to become a sustainable income source for developers and to create a privacy-respecting ecosystem with real alternatives to exploitative cloud services.

#

That’s why we ask you to pay for a product key

little zenith
#

Everything is local to your machine, we don't do any kind of federation or maintenance

median elm
#

"Product key" implies there's like...a product

edgy burrow
#

yes, Immich is the product

#

We don't believe open source needs to be antithetical to selling the software, as Immich does take a lot of money to make (multiple full time employees)

#

We remain GPL licensed and no paywalls
